Nellie Clay Illinois

Western folk singer-songwriter Nellie Clay has recorded two full length albums & three more recent EP's.

Originally from Oklahoma, Clay also called Alaska and Nashville home for years.

She has sang alongside and opened for Grammy nominated artists and had her national television debut on the PBS show Songs at The Center.

Nellie is also a visual artist and is currently writing her first book.
